Asian Junior
and Asian Games - two major events in rowing calendar
by Leslie Fernando Sri Lanka will be involved in five major rowing championships for the year 2006, two foreign regattas in Singapore and Doha, Qatar and three championships here. Deva Henry, the President of the Amateur Rowing Association of Sri Lanka (ARASL) said that in addition to the five major international championship meets Sri Lanka will also concentrate on domestic events. The championships at which our rowers will participate are Asian Junior Rowing Championships in Singapore in June, the prestigious Colombo - Madras Regatta in Colombo in July South Asian Games in Colombo, August Amateur Rowing Association of East Regatta in Colombo date not (finalised) and Asian games in Doha, Qatar in December. The ARASL under the leadership of Deva Henry has made steady progress last year with all annual fixtures carried out successfully. The Amateur Rowing Association of East Regatta was not held in Chennai in December as it was flooded. Two of our rowers R.D.S.Fonseka and V.G.N.Santha of Sri Lanka Navy fared well at the Asian Rowing Championships held in Hyderabad, being placed 5th and 6th in the Single Sculls and Double Sculls amongst 53 oarsmen that participated. Henry who is also a senior vice-president of National Olympic Committee added that the national training pool comprising of 32 rowers will begin training on the Beira waters from end of this month in preparation for the South Asian Games to be held in Colombo in August. The rowers will train under Lakmal Wickremage, National coach and Saliya Wijesekera assistant coach. The ARASL will meet on January 11 at the Colombo Rowing Club pavilion to discuss further plans on rowing promotion and also with regard to the imports of new boats for the use of the rowers. Prior to south Asian Games. The opening regatta for the year will take place on February 18 on Beira Waters, Colombo Rowing Club. The events to be worked off are pairs for Vanlangenburg Trophy, sculls for Golden Armstrong Trophy, fours for HMS Enterprise Trophy, Ladies pairs for novices and junior. |
